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
JavaScript Python
branch: master

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
_assets
templates/ui
ui
README.markdown cleanup
__init__.py first
__init__.pyc
manage.py
ploud.db
settings.py
settings.pyc first
urls.py
urls.pyc

README.markdown

Ploud UI Development

Overview

Defining the UI for Ploud.

Pages

1. Home Page
2. Dashboard
3. Reset Password (Modal)
4. Reset Password (Non-modal)
5. Membership/Profile
6. Membership/Profile (Dropdown)
7. Home Page (Logged In)

Todo

1. Set up Colorbox or alternative for Modals
    a. Determine content for modals
2. Consider Apprise
3. Mobile Considerations
4. Determine content for Profile/Membership
5. Set up jQuery Waypoints
6. Consider lazy loading
7. Drag-n-drop arrangement of Dashboard
8. Determine Existing Sites CTAs
9. Set up validation: Formly or jQuery Validation
10. Produce or determine appropriate icon set
11. Determine additional pages, full content of existing pages
12. Assess the footer
13. Icons for text inputs?
14. Consider fat footer

Error Handling

Three types of error presentation:

1. site-wide (using .mod-status-message; should not be rendered if not postback)
2. in-form (using .mod-status-message; should always have "hide" @class)
3. inline (DOM injection)
Something went wrong with that request. Please try again.